Sahib Mammadzade

Sahib Mammadzade – member of the Popular Front Party of Azerbaijan Date of arrest: 18 March 2024 Charge: Article 234.4.3 (Illegal manufacturing, purchase, storage, transportation, transfer or selling of narcotics, psychotropic substances committed in large amount) of the Criminal Code of the Azerbaijan Republic.

On 19 March 2024, the Goygol District Court issued a ruling: to apply a preventive measure against Sahib Mammadzade in the form of arrest for a period of 4 months.

The period of detention in custody during the investigation has been subsequently extended times Sentence: On 10 December 2024, the Ganja City Court for Serious Crimes sentenced to 6 years and 6 months in prison Sentence: On 7 March 2025, the Baku City Court of Appeal issued a verdict: since the prosecution failed to provide any convincing evidence in the course of the trial, the Judge substituted the previous Article of the Prosecution with a new one, 234.1-1 (Illegal acquisition or storage of drugs or psychotropic substances without the purpose of sale in an amount exceeding the amount necessary for personal consumption, committed in a large amount) of the Criminal Code of the Azerbaijan Republic.

And afterwards Baku City Court of Appeal reduced the term of imprisonment of Sahib Mammadzade to 3 years and 6 months Place of detention: Pre-trial Detention Center at the Umbaki settlement in Baku City Qaradaq District Conclusion: In the evening of 18 March 2024, Sahib Mammadzade, the Head of the Dashkesan district branch of the PFPA, was stopped and beaten by the masked men, then taken away in an unknown direction.

According to the Head of the PFPA press service, Natiq Adilov, "Sahib Mammadzade was transporting his cattle in a lorry from a lowland pasture to a summer one in the direction of the mountainside village of Khoshbulag.

His vehicle was stopped at the police checkpoint near Bayan village, Dashkesan district, and the black- masked men got Sahib Mammadzade out and dragged him into another car, beating him, and then drove away in an unknown direction.

His sister, who was sitting in the cabin of the truck, tried to film the incident on video, but her phone was confiscated.

Sahib's relatives called the Interior Ministry's hotline.

However, they have not been able to get any information about Sahib, and the police claimed that he had not detained Sahib, although his arrest took place at a police checkpoint.

However, the following day, 19 March 2024, the police said that he had been detained for drug trafficking.

The lawyer, Zabil Qahramanov, said that on 19 March 2024, S.

Mammadzade was taken into custody for a period of 4 months following a ruling of the Goygel District Court.

The PFPA members believe that Mammadzade's detention is due to his political activities.

"Sahib Mammadzade is the Head of the Dashkesan district PFPA branch, respected by the local residents. “Besides, he had livestock, was able to provide some financial help to support the families of political prisoners," added Natiq Adilov. 50 According to the lawyer, Zabil Qahramanov, the Court issuing the guilty verdict did not prove that the drugs belonged to his client, ‘Mammadzade said that it was the police officers who had planted the drugs.

The witnesses questioned at the trial stated that they had not seen any drugs in Mammadzade’s possession.

Mammadzade claimed that he had being persecuted for his opposition activities as the Head of PPFA Dashkesan district ".
